What happened

Israel's High Court of Justice has ordered the removal of illegal construction at Bora Bora beach on the Sea of Galilee, mandating free public access to the area. The ruling aims to restore public access to the beach, which had been obstructed by unauthorized structures.

  • 01Court orders removal of illegal construction at Bora Bora beach.
  • 02The Sea of Galilee beach must be freely accessible to the public.
  • 03The ruling addresses unauthorized development on public land.
